Prunus mume Peggy Clarke is a variety of Japanese Apricot and features masses of pretty flowers in spring. The double, pink blooms are borne in clusters through spring, just before the foliage begins to emerge. This deciduous bears green foliage which develops yellow and orange tones in autumn before falling as it grows to 5 m tall and 4 m wide. Prunus Peggy Clarke is commonly used in avenue plantings, grown as a specimen, or included in a mixed planting.
